All of us at some point in our career experience physical pain while operating. We were lucky to be joined by Dr. Geeta Lal (@geetalalmd on twitter) on the show today to talk about the concept of surgical ergonomics. Make sure you check out the YouTube version of this episode, for a special segment where Dr. Lal looks at some actual footage of us operating and makes some recommendations on what we might do differently. This is such an important conversation on how we can take care of ourselves so we can better care for our patients.

Bio:

Dr. Geeta Lal is a board-certified General Surgeon (both USA and Canada) with advanced Fellowship training in Endocrine Surgical Oncology. She is also a tenured Associate Professor of Surgery with a cross-appointment in Pediatrics at a major academic medical center. Dr. Lal has spent the last 17 years practicing Endocrine surgery and has extensive experience in thyroid and parathyroid surgery, including re-operative surgery and pediatric thyroid cancer. She is also involved in teaching surgical residents and medical students, both in the operating room and clinics.

Dr. Lal has served in many different roles throughout her career, including being the Co-Leader of her cancer center’s Endocrine Multidisciplinary Oncology Group and heading an NIH-funded basic science laboratory focused on the role of the Extracellular Matrix 1 (ECM1) gene for many years. She has since transitioned from the lab into an administrative role as the Associate Chief Quality Officer for the Adult Inpatient Services at her hospital. Dr. Lal continues to perform both clinical and quality and safety research and has presented and published her work extensively.
